Looking for a clear, concise book on leadership? This re-write of a popular 1988 management book gives you an easy-to-understand system. As you implement the twelve elements of The Process of Excelling, you'll significantly improve your effectiveness in leading in today's employee-centered, results-focused environment.

Each element of The Process is presented in clear, concise terms: 1. A Sense of Direction 2. Clarity of Expectations 3. Results-Oriented Leadership 4. Responsibility, Authority, Accountability 5. Know Your People 6. Inspiration and Support 7. Involvement 8. Feedback and Recognition 9. Managing Priorities and Time 10. Communication 11. Competence, Confidence, and Growth 12. Commitment Questions at the end of each chapter enhance your learning.

This book is recommended for supervisors, middle managers shifting from management to leadership, and executives who can benefit from a refresher about the techniques that work.
